What Does WWA Meaning in Text & Chat Mean?

In most casual texting contexts, WWA is used as an informal abbreviation that usually stands for:

“What’s Wrong Again?” or “What’s Wrong With You?”

However, its meaning is not fixed. It can change depending on tone and situation. In some conversations, it is used jokingly, while in others it may sound slightly annoyed or curious.

In simple words, WWA is a reaction phrase used when someone is trying to ask what happened or why someone is acting a certain way.

Example intent:

  • Confusion
  • Light teasing
  • Asking for explanation
  • Reacting to unusual behavior

Full Form, Stands For & Short Meaning of WWA

WWA does not have a single official full form, but the most common interpretations are:

  • What’s Wrong Again
  • What’s Wrong With You
  • Why Weird Action (rare informal use)

In texting culture, abbreviations often evolve naturally, so meanings depend heavily on context rather than strict definitions.

How People Use WWA in Daily Conversations

WWA is mainly used in informal digital communication. It usually appears when someone reacts to unexpected behavior or wants clarification.

Texting examples:

  • “WWA bro, why you ignoring everyone?”
  • “WWA, you acting so different today 😂”
  • “WWA now? You just said you were fine!”

Social media usage:

  • Comment sections when someone posts something unusual
  • Instagram DMs to react quickly
  • TikTok replies for humorous confusion

Casual situations:

  • Friends teasing each other
  • Group chats reacting to drama
  • Light confrontation in a joking tone

Common Confusions, Mistakes & Wrong Interpretations

Many people misunderstand WWA because:

  • They think it is a typo of “WYA” (Where You At)
  • They assume it is formal or professional jargon
  • They confuse it with similar acronyms like “WYD” or “WTH”

Another common mistake is assuming WWA always sounds rude. In reality, tone matters a lot. It can be funny, caring, or slightly annoyed depending on how it is said.

FAQs

What does WWA mean on Snapchat?

On Snapchat, WWA usually means “What’s wrong with you” or “What’s wrong again.” It is used in quick reactions when someone posts or says something unusual. The tone is often playful, not serious, and depends on the friendship between users.

Is WWA rude?

WWA is not always rude. It depends on tone. Among friends, it is often joking or teasing. However, if used sharply, it can sound slightly annoyed. Emojis and context usually make the meaning clear in conversation.

What does WWA mean from a girl?

If a girl says WWA, it usually means she is reacting to something you did or said. It could be playful curiosity, teasing, or concern. The relationship and conversation tone matter more than the phrase itself.

What does WWA mean from a guy?

When a guy uses WWA, it is often casual or joking. It may mean he is surprised, confused, or teasing you about your behavior. It is commonly used in friendly chats or group conversations.

Is WWA the same as WYD?

No, they are different. WYD means “What You Doing,” while WWA usually means “What’s Wrong With You/Again.” WYD asks about activity, while WWA reacts to behavior or emotion.

Can WWA be used in formal messages?

No, WWA is strictly informal slang. It should not be used in professional emails, official chats, or workplace communication. It is only suitable for casual texting with friends.

Why do people use WWA instead of full sentences?

People use WWA because it is faster and easier to type. In online chatting, short forms save time and make conversations feel more natural, especially in fast-paced group chats.
